Am I eligible for a Ring Protect plan?
After you set up your Ring device (doorbell or camera) then you are eligible to purchase a Ring Protect Plan. Before you set up a device, you can review what plan would work best for you. A free 30-day trial of Ring Protect starts immediately when you set up your device, unless you have an existing plan at your location. This way you can use the benefits while you decide what plan is best for you. Multi and AI Pro Plans cover all devices at your home, and Solo covers one device.

Is a Ring Protect Plan required to use my Ring products?
No. Your Ring products provide certain core features such as Live View, Two-Way Talk, Standard Motion Notifications and more without a Ring Protect plan.
Can I try Ring Protect before I subscribe?
Yes. A free 30-day trial of Ring Protect starts when you first set up your Ring doorbell or camera (unless you have an existing plan at your location). If you are activating a device at a location that is already covered by a Multi or AI Pro Plan, your new home device is already covered.
What happens when I add a new Ring device?
With a Ring Protect Multi or AI Pro Plan, all devices at one location are covered automatically. If you're currently on a Solo Plan and want to add more home devices at the same address, you can upgrade to Multi or AI Pro to cover any additional devices and enjoy our most advanced features.
I have one Ring Doorbell or Camera. Which Ring Protect Plan is best for me?
Ring Protect Solo plan will cover you for one single device and you can choose to purchase an Add-On pack for additional features. If you purchase an additional device in the future, we recommend you upgrade to a Ring Multi or AI Pro Plan depending on your preference to cover multiple devices.
I have Ring products at more than one address. Does one Ring Protect Plan cover them all?
No. You'll need to subscribe to a separate Ring Protect Plan for each address you want to cover.
Can I manage my Ring devices from multiple mobile phones or tablets?
Yes. Every Ring device can be monitored and managed in the Ring app by an unlimited number of mobile phones and tablets, as well as by signing in to Ring.com on a computer (certain features may not be available on computer).
Which forms of payment are accepted for Ring Protect Plans?
Ring only accepts digital credit or debit card payments and any other payment methods offered through our website Ring.com. We do not accept any payments in the form of cash, check, or money order. Any such payments sent to our address will be returned to you, and you will be instructed to subscribe and pay for Ring Protect Plans online. Payments that are mailed to Ring may cause a lapse in your plan coverage. If you do not subscribe and pay for a Ring Protect Plan online within your trial period, or prior to the expiration of your existing subscription plan, you will lose your stored video recordings, and they will not be retrievable.

How long do my videos stay in my Ring account?
Your Ring motion event videos are stored in the cloud for up to 180 days for doorbells and home cameras.
